Vaibhav Sooryavanshi in focus as India take on Afghanistan in T20 series
India will begin their three-match T20I series against Afghanistan in New Delhi on Sunday with teenage sensation Vaibhav Sooryavanshi attracting plenty of attention. The 15-year-old was among just three Indian players who attended an optional practice session at the Arun Jaitley Stadium on Saturday, along with Tilak Varma and Abhishek Sharma. The young cricketer has been consistently performing well in recent matches, including a standout performance in the Zimbabwe series where he topped the run scoring charts.
India's captain Shreyas Iyer faces a tricky decision as he must choose between Sooryavanshi and Sanju Samson for the top spot in the batting order. Iyer emphasized the importance of keeping the other players who have not made it into the playing XI confident and prepared to make an impact when their turn comes. Afghanistan captain Ibrahim Zadran revealed that his team has meticulously studied Sooryavanshi's game, using insights from players who faced him in the Indian Premier League.
Zadran expressed confidence in his team's preparation, particularly in handling the formidable Indian pacer Jasprit Bumrah.
